Great not Perfect: Used absolutely perfectly, only 2% of women a year will still get pregnant when their partners use condoms. But 18% of women get pregnant in general with condoms since condoms are often used carelessly. Use spermicide with condoms. For latex condoms, water-based lubricants, such as k-y jelly or astroglide are safe but oil based lubricants like petroleum jelly, damage the condom and make it leak.
